  1. How can my son or daughter make friends?

    There a variety of ways your child can make friends at University, including Freshers' Week, more than 50 clubs and societies, and the the SU Buddies scheme.

  2. How can the University help if my child is sad, unhappy or ill?

    Our Health and Wellbeing service has a range of Health Professionals including counsellors, mental health advisors and general nurses...

  3. My child has additional learning needs – what support is available?

    The University offers a support service for students with disabilities and students who have a specific learning difficulty, such as dyslexia. Our Disability Support Team can also offer advice and guidance...
